Toledo Metro Area industry wages have increased by 13.5% percent since 2001


(Click Image to Enlarge Graph)



From the second quarter of 2001 to the second quarter of 2006, industry wages have increased in the Toledo Metro Area by a total of 13.5%. This is less than the growth in average industry wages for Ohio and less than the growth in industry wages across the US.

Toledo Metro Area Industry Wages Lag Behind Ohio, and Wages Lag Behind the United States Industry Wages


(Click Image to Enlarge Graph)



Total wages in all industries in Toledo, OH when analyzed can be understood as being medium-high when analyzed with other 2nd quarter of 2006 Metro Area wages throughout the US. The average pay is 5.1 percent lower than the state, which was reported to be $36,666. The industry pay was less than the national industry average of $40,259.
